Capt'n Fun Bushwacker 5K hits Pensacola Beach

2006-08-01 / Happenings

The Capt'n Fun Bushwacker 5K Run returns to Pensacola Beach this year after last year's relocation to Downtown Pensacola. The run will be held Saturday, Aug. 5, 2006, at 7:30 a.m., and is sponsored by the Capt'n Fun Runners to benefit Big Brothers Big Sisters of Northwest Florida.

The race follows a 3.1 mile point-to-point course that begins in Gulf Breeze at the South Santa Rosa Recreation Center on Shoreline Drive and finishes on Pensacola Beach at the Visitor Information Center.

The post-race party will be held at the Quietwater Beach Boardwalk on Pensacola Beach and will include awards, food, refreshments and live music by Main Street Band.
